The video tutorial explains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) as essential tools for measuring progress towards business objectives. It covers the types of KPIs, including leading and lagging indicators, and outlines six characteristics of effective KPIs. The tutorial also provides guidelines for creating KPIs, emphasizing the importance of aligning them with strategic goals and ensuring they are SMART (Significant,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Trackable, Ethical, Supported, and Time-bound). The use of KPIs in project management and their role in improving performance are also discussed.
